Why oven and stoves fail in Opal
Ovens and ranges are the least climate-sensitive appliances in the house, so we will not pretend the weather drives their failures — igniters, bake elements, control boards and door hinges do. Usage here stays fairly even year-round (NOAA 1991–2020, Quantico Mcas station 28 mi away), so failures come from accumulated cycles rather than any seasonal spike.

What Opal's climate does to appliances
Opal averages a July high near 88°F and a January low around 28°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als, Quantico Mcas station, 28 mi away). Opal gets 3 months averaging 80°F or hotter, so refrigeration strain is seasonal rather than constant — cooling calls cluster in mid-summer. With 3 cool months (highs at or below 50°F), dryer use climbs noticeably in winter. January lows dip to about 28°F, so unheated garages and exterior laundry walls can see occasional freezing.

Is it safe to keep a refrigerator or freezer in my garage in Opal?
Cold is the concern in Opal. January lows around 28°F can drop a garage below the range a standard refrigerator handles; because many models sense temperature only in the fresh-food section, the compressor stops running and the freezer quietly thaws. A garage-ready unit solves it.
Can freezing weather damage my washer or ice maker in Opal?
Occasionally. Opal averages January lows near 28°F, so a hard cold snap can freeze an ice-maker line or a washer hose in an unheated garage or against an exterior wall. It is not a constant threat, but it is worth insulating exposed lines before winter.
